Drywall bead such as j bead and corner bead covers the raw edges and corners of drywall.
A perfectly positioned corner bead protrudes slightly at the corner to allow a void for joint compound.
Check both sides in several places along the length of the corner.

Builders use j bead to cap the end of drywall sheets where the sheets butt against dissimilar building materials such as metal or masonry or where the drywall s edge remains exposed such as surrounding an attic access panel.
Drywall corner bead can be installed with nails screws adhesive staples or other means.
